CYTENA is a biotechnology instruments company that specializes in automated single-cell handling to accelerate biotherapeutic drug development. Its systems isolate individual cells with imaging-based confirmation of clonality and can work with a variety of cell types, including bacteria, while maintaining high viability without cell labeling. A disposable cartridge design helps ensure sample purity and minimizes cross-contamination, facilitating integration into existing workflows. The company has developed the C.STATION platform, a fully automated cell line development system that supports cloning, selection of high-producing clones, and upscaling.

Based in Freiburg im Breisgau, Baden-Württemberg, CYTENA operates within the biotechnology research sector, serving pharmaceutical companies and academic researchers pursuing efficient cell line development and single-cell analysis. Its instruments are used by numerous large pharmaceutical firms to rapidly generate monoclonal cell lines for antibody development with minimized cross-contamination risk, and they support academic research in cancer, autoimmune disease, and genomics, with a May 2024 launch of C.WASH PLUS illustrating ongoing product development.
